PROCUREMENT:

This purchase order procures two Aqua Guard self-cleaning bar/filter screens to replace the existing screens at the South Water Reclamation Facility (SWRF). This purchase is inclusive of installation of the screens and control panels, testing, mechanical warranty, and removal of the existing screens.

REMARKS:

The existing Aqua Guard self cleaning bar/filter screens at SWRF were installed in 2009. They are approaching the end of their useful life and have corroded over time, requiring replacement. Due to the propriety design of the screens and regulatory requirements, replacing the existing screens with a different model or brand would require modifications to the facility’s infrastructure and control systems. These modifications to the facility infrastructure potentially compromise integration with the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ition system and disrupt operation and maintenance protocols. Parkson Corporation is the manufacturer and has been verified as the sole provider for the Aqua Guard screens and is the only source of replacement parts for existing equipment.   Pricing was determined to be fair and reasonable in comparison to quotes obtained in 2024 for replacement screens and similar purchases made by the City of Port St. Lucie in 2024 and the City of Melbourne in 2025.
